Get all of your documents together before seeking a home loan. Having your information available can make the process go more quickly. The lender wants to see all this material, so having it handy can save you another trip to the bank.
In order to be approved for a home loan, you need a good work history. Many lenders need a history of steady work for two years for approving a loan. Job hopping can be a disqualifier. In addition, do not quit your job when you are in the middle of a loan process.

Try to find the lowest available interest rate. The goal of the bank is to lock you in at the highest rate that they can. Avoid falling prey to their plan. Shop around to see a few options to pick from.

If your mortgage has a 30 year term, you should think about paying an extra payment each month. This will pay off your principal. Making an extra payment often gets your mortgage paid off faster and saves you money on interest.

ARM is a term referring to an adjustable rate mortgage, and they readjust when their expiration date comes up. The new mortgage rate will automatically be whatever rate is applicable then. Therefore, it is possible that the interest rate will be very high.

Know as much as you can about all fees prior to signing any agreement for the mortgage. There will be itemized closing costs, as well as commissions and miscellaneous charges you need to be aware of. You might be able to negotiate these with either the lender or seller.

If it is within your budget, consider 15 or 20-year loans. These loans usually have a lower interest rate and a higher monthly payment for the shorter loan period. You are able to save thousands of dollars in the future.

A high credit score is important for getting the best mortgage rate in our current tight lending market. Get your credit scores from the big agencies so that you can check the report. Banks usually avoid consumers with a score of less than 620.
The interest rate you can secure on a mortgage is important, but it is not the only factor to consider. There may be other fees, which can vary by lender. Do not forget to include closing costs, any points and even the particular type of loan that is being offered. Pick your loan only after you have quotes from several sources.

Consider getting a home mortgage that allows you to make payments every two weeks. This causes you to pay two additional payments a year and lowers the interest amount you pay and shortens your loan term. Payments that are made biweekly can make it easier to have it directly withdrawn from your checking account.

Having an approval letter will show to the seller that you are interested in buying a home now. It shows them that you are financially stable. The approval letter should be the amount of the offer you make. If the letter indicates you are able to pay more than you are offering, the seller has more negotiating power.
Don’t do anything to lower your credit score prior to the loan closing. The lender will probably check your score right before making the final loan terms. They can still take the loan back if you have since accumulated additional debt.

If you have credit issues or none at all, you’ll have to take a non-traditional loan route. Keep payment record you can for up to a minimum of 12 months. This will show that you prove yourself to a lender.
You might have to investigate alternative sources as a means of getting a mortgage approval if your credit is bad, thin or nonexistent. Make sure you hang onto all payments records for at least the past year. Proving that you have paid your rent and utility bills on time is helpful for borrowers with thin credit.

Prior to applying for your mortgage, have a good amount of cash saved up. Depending on the type of loan and lender, you will most likely need around 3.5% to put down. The higher it goes, the better. If your down payment is less than twenty percent, you’ll need to pay for private mortgage insurance.

Keep in mind that a steeper commission is given to mortgage brokers who get you to sign off on a fixed-rate solution as opposed to a variable-rate. They may emphasize the possibility of rate hikes to steer you in their favor. You are the ultimate decider of what kind of mortgage you want to take.
